The selected candidate will:
- Perform work based on sketches, engineering drawings, and schematics.
- Follow steps documented in procedures, task performance sheets, discrepancy report interim dispositions, procedures and WADs.
- Obtain certifications for and remain proficient in the following:
- Surface Mount Soldering
- Thru-Hole Soldering
- Crimping, Interconnecting Cables, harnesses and Wiring
- Conformal Coating and Staking
- Electrostatic Discharge Control
- Lithium Battery Handling
- Foreign Object Debris Control
- Perform printed circuit board assembly and repair which includes assembly cleanliness verification, demoisturization, masking/de-masking and conformal coating.
- Perform Cable and harness fabrication, assembly, and repair.
- Perform Electromechanical fabrication, assembly and repair.
- Perform other electromechanical assembly operations such as but not limited to soldering, crimping, staking, swaging, torqueing, marking.
- Perform Flight Hardware builds in a Flight Hardware production lab.
- Identify existing and potential issues during design review, fabrication, modification and/or repair of hardware and immediately communicate issues to staff.
- Modify and repair commercial off-the-shelf hardware.
- Conduct parts and calibrated tools inventory and perform other laboratory duties as required.
- Maintain a safe, clean and orderly work area and adhere to laboratory policies.
- Coach and mentor lesser skilled technicians.
- Work after hours and/or weekends as required.
- Perform related duties as required.
